NATO chief  visiting Kiev on Thursday to hold Ukraine-NATO

 

Monitoring Desk: NATO chief Anders Rasmussen  is visiting Kiev to hold meeting for Ukraine-NATO dialogue on Thursday.

NATO Secretary General Anders Fogh Rasmussen will visit Ukraine on August 7, Head of Ukraine’s Mission to NATO, Ambassador Ihor Dolhov, has said.

NATO authorities are linking Rasmussen visit to Kiev to discuss NATO summit scheduled to be held on September 4-5 in the United Kingdom stating that Rasmussen visit to Kyiv on August 7 will be fruitful and important for preparations for the summit. However, pro Russian politicians are considering this visit “too early for preparation of summit” and considering his visit to discuss and share military campaign against rebels in Eastern Ukraine and Kiev-Moscow relations.

“There are possibilities of direct involvement of NATO in Ukrainian and Russian conflict”, said observers.
